重构智能配置:从繁琐到自动化的OpenCore EFI技术革命
【免费下载链接】OpCore-SimplifyA tool designed to simplify the creation of OpenCore EFI项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
在Hackintosh领域,OpenCore EFI配置一直是技术爱好者面临的重大挑战。传统配置过程需要手动处理大量参数,从ACPI补丁到内核扩展,每一步都充满不确定性。OpCore-Simplify作为一款颠覆性的自动化工具,正通过技术简化和效率提升,彻底改变这一现状,让复杂的配置过程变得前所未有的简单。
【问题诊断】OpenCore配置的核心痛点分析
如何突破传统配置方法的技术瓶颈?在深入了解OpCore-Simplify之前,我们首先需要认识传统配置方式存在的根本问题:
- 硬件适配复杂性:不同品牌、型号的硬件需要特定的驱动和补丁,手动匹配过程耗时且容易出错
- 版本兼容性迷宫:macOS版本与硬件的匹配关系复杂,错误选择可能导致系统不稳定
- 参数调优门槛高:OpenCore配置文件中数百个参数需要精确调整,对新手极不友好
- 维护成本高昂:系统更新或硬件更换后,需要重新配置整个EFI,维护难度大
这些问题不仅浪费大量时间,还常常导致配置失败,打击用户积极性。
技术启示:识别问题本质是解决问题的第一步。OpCore-Simplify的价值在于它直击传统配置方法的痛点,通过自动化手段消除人为错误和重复劳动。
【方案解构】OpCore-Simplify的技术透视
硬件特征智能识别系统
OpCore-Simplify的核心优势在于其先进的硬件特征智能识别系统。该系统通过分析硬件的关键参数,如CPU微架构、显卡型号和芯片组特性,建立全面的硬件档案。不同于传统工具需要手动输入硬件信息,该系统能够自动扫描并识别几乎所有主流硬件配置。
如图所示,系统会清晰显示各硬件组件的兼容性状态,包括支持的macOS版本范围。对于不兼容的硬件(如示例中的NVIDIA GTX 1650 Ti),系统会明确标记并提供替代方案建议。
动态配置生成引擎
配置生成引擎是OpCore-Simplify的另一核心组件。基于硬件识别结果,该引擎会:
- 从内置数据库中匹配最佳配置模板
- 根据硬件特性动态调整关键参数
- 智能选择必要的ACPI补丁和内核扩展
- 优化SMBIOS设置以确保系统稳定性
这一过程完全自动化,消除了手动配置的复杂性和出错风险。
技术启示:自动化配置的核心在于将专家知识编码为算法,使普通用户也能获得专业级的配置方案。OpCore-Simplify通过将复杂的硬件适配逻辑内置到系统中,大幅降低了技术门槛。
【实践路径】OpCore-Simplify的核心使用方法
如何快速部署OpCore-Simplify工具?
操作要点:根据操作系统选择合适的启动方式
- Windows系统:双击运行OpCore-Simplify.bat
- macOS系统:执行OpCore-Simplify.command
- Linux系统:使用Python运行OpCore-Simplify.py
预期效果:工具启动后将自动初始化运行环境,并展示欢迎界面和使用向导。
注意事项:确保系统已安装Python 3.8或更高版本,以及必要的依赖库。可以通过以下命令安装依赖:
git clone https://gitcode.com/GitHub_Trending/op/OpCore-Simplify cd OpCore-Simplify pip install -r requirements.txt硬件兼容性检测的关键步骤
操作要点:启动工具后,在主界面选择"硬件检测"选项,系统将自动扫描硬件配置。
预期效果:生成详细的硬件兼容性报告,显示各组件对不同macOS版本的支持情况。
注意事项:检测过程可能需要30秒到2分钟,具体时间取决于硬件复杂度。保持网络连接,以便工具获取最新的硬件兼容性数据。
如何使用高级配置界面进行个性化设置?
操作要点:在完成硬件检测后,进入配置界面,可调整以下关键参数:
- 目标macOS版本选择
- ACPI补丁配置
- 内核扩展管理
- 音频布局ID设置
- SMBIOS型号选择
预期效果:生成符合个人需求的定制化EFI配置方案。
注意事项:高级用户可通过"Configure Patches"和"Manage Kexts"按钮进行深度定制,但建议新手保持默认设置以确保系统稳定性。
技术启示:好的工具应该平衡自动化和灵活性,既为新手提供一键式解决方案,又为高级用户保留手动调整的空间。OpCore-Simplify的分层设计满足了不同用户群体的需求。
【价值延伸】传统方案VS创新方案
传统配置方案与OpCore-Simplify创新方案的对比:
传统方案往往需要用户手动收集硬件信息,查阅大量教程和论坛帖子,然后逐个配置参数。这个过程通常需要数小时甚至数天,且成功率不高。用户需要具备深入的系统知识,包括ACPI原理、内核扩展机制和SMBIOS特性等。
相比之下,OpCore-Simplify将这一过程缩短到几分钟。通过自动化的硬件检测和配置生成,用户无需深入了解底层技术细节。系统会自动处理复杂的兼容性判断和参数优化,大大提高了配置成功率。
OpCore-Simplify的核心价值
- 效率提升:将配置时间从数小时缩短至几分钟,大幅提高工作效率
- 技术简化:消除专业知识壁垒,使普通用户也能完成专业级配置
- 可靠性增强:基于大量成功案例优化的配置方案,显著提高系统稳定性
- 维护便捷:提供配置备份和恢复功能,简化系统更新和硬件更换后的重新配置
技术启示:真正的技术创新不仅要提高效率,更要降低使用门槛,让更多人能够享受技术带来的便利。OpCore-Simplify通过自动化和智能化手段,实现了Hackintosh配置技术的民主化。
结语:开启智能配置新时代
OpCore-Simplify不仅是一个工具,更是Hackintosh配置理念的革新。它将复杂的技术细节隐藏在简洁的界面之后,让用户能够专注于创造性的工作而非繁琐的配置过程。无论是硬件爱好者、开发者还是普通用户,都能通过这款工具轻松构建稳定高效的Hackintosh系统。
随着技术的不断发展,我们有理由相信,OpCore-Simplify将继续进化,整合更多智能算法和社区经验,为用户提供更加完善的配置体验。现在就加入这场配置革命,体验智能自动化带来的全新可能!
【免费下载链接】OpCore-SimplifyA tool designed to simplify the creation of OpenCore EFI项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考